ramips: 5.10: port and refresh patches, ralink drv

Enable testing kernel.

Fix compile errors by using new kernel APIs.

Fix fuzz by manually editing patches to ensure the code goes in the
right place.

For 721-NET-no-auto-carrier-off-support.patch, revert upstream commit
a307593a6 to keep the OpenWrt ralink driver operational.

Add mt7621-pci-phy patch to select REGMAP_MMIO as discussed in PR #3693
and #3952.

Run automatic quilt refresh on the rest.

Signed-off-by: Ilya Lipnitskiy <ilya.lipnitskiy@gmail.com>
